ABSTRACT

“Thrombus-in-transit” in pulmonary embolism is associated with high mortality and refers to a free-floating clot in the right atrium or right ventricle, indicating that deep vein thrombosis is present en route to the pulmonary artery. Thrombus entrapped in a patent foramen ovale (PFO) is a rare condition and is associated with paradoxical systemic embolism. Here, we report a case of acute pulmonary embolism with thrombus-in-transit through a PFO in a 68-year-old woman with a diagnosis of metastatic pancreatic cancer undergoing palliative chemotherapy. She presented with syncope after acute onset of exertional dyspnea and was diagnosed with cardiogenic shock due to massive pulmonary embolism with thrombus-in-transit on admission to the emergency room. We treated her with systemic thrombolysis and anticoagulation therapy instead of surgical thrombectomy. We show that hemodynamically unstable pulmonary embolism with thrombus-in-transit entrapped by a PFO may be successfully treated with systemic thrombolysis without paradoxical embolism.

ABSTRACT

BACKGROUND: The purpose of this study is to analyze the cost for the denture treatment in accordance with the government's plan to expand the National Health Insurance coverage for dental prothesis from July 1, 2012. METHODS: We developed the draft of classification of the treatment activities based on the existing researches and expert's review and finalized the standard procedures through confirming by Korean Dental Association. We also made the list of input at each stage of treatments. We conducted survey of 100 dental clinics via post from April 4 to May 20 in 2011 and 37 clinics took part in the survey. The unit of cost calculation is the process from the first visit for denture treatment to setting of denture and adjustment. The manufacturing process performed by dental technician was not included in the cost analysis. RESULTS: The process for the complete denture treatment was classified with 10 stages. The partial denture treatment was classified with 8 stages. The treatment time per each denture is about 5.6 hours for complete dentures and about 6.6 hours for partial dentures. The treatment cost were from 591,108 won to 643,913 won for complete denture and from 670,219 won to 738,840 won for partial denture in 2011, depending on the location, type of the clinics and the types of physician's income. CONCLUSION: This study shows the example of cost analysis for the treatment to set the fee schedule. Measures to get representative and accurate information need to be made.
